Impara una gestione efficiente dei dati in Python con l’integrazione di SQLite. Semplifica l’archiviazione, il recupero e la manipolazione per migliorare le prestazioni delle applicazioni.
Equipment list
Here you can find the list of equipment used to create this tutorial.
This link will also show the software list used to create this tutorial.
Esercitazione correlata – Python
In questa pagina, offriamo un rapido accesso a un elenco di tutorial relativi a Python.
Che cos’è SQLite?
SQLite è un sistema di gestione di database relazionali popolare, leggero e autonomo. È ampiamente utilizzato grazie alla sua semplicità, efficienza e facilità di integrazione. A differenza dei sistemi di gestione di database client-server, SQLite è serverless e opera direttamente dai file di database, il che lo rende facile da configurare e utilizzare, soprattutto nei sistemi embedded e nelle applicazioni su piccola scala.
Perché usare SQLite con Python?
SQLite è impiegato con Python per la sua integrazione user-friendly, che si rivolge ad applicazioni di piccole e medie dimensioni che richiedono l’archiviazione locale dei dati. La sua perfetta compatibilità e la configurazione minima completano la semplicità di Python, consentendo agli sviluppatori di gestire in modo efficiente i database.
SQLite va bene per Python?
SQLite è adatto per l’uso con Python. Si integra perfettamente con Python grazie alla sua semplicità ed efficienza, il che lo rende una scelta eccellente per le applicazioni che richiedono un database locale. Con il supporto integrato di Python per SQLite e la disponibilità del modulo SQLITE3, gli sviluppatori possono facilmente creare, manipolare e gestire database SQLite, migliorando le capacità di archiviazione e recupero dei dati all’interno delle applicazioni Python.
Tutorial Python – Utilizzo del database SQLite
Stabilire una connessione al database.
Se il file del database dei file non esiste, la funzione connect lo creerà.
Creare un oggetto cursore.
Creare una tabella nel database utilizzando il cursore.
In questo modo viene creata una tabella nel database SQLite connesso. Definisce la struttura della tabella con cinque colonne: ID come chiave primaria impostata sull’incremento automatico, NAME, SPECIAL_MOVE, SS_LEVEL e EYE_COLOR.
Inserire i dati nella tabella.
Esistono diversi modi per inserire i dati nella tabella.
Salvare le modifiche apportate alla tabella.
Recuperare le informazioni memorizzate all’interno della tabella.
Consente di visualizzare le informazioni recuperate sotto forma di tupla.
Ecco l’output del comando.
Visualizzare le informazioni recuperate come stringa formattata.
Ecco l’output del comando.
Facoltativamente, restituire i dati in formato dizionario, che consentirà di accedere ai valori utilizzando le chiavi.
Ecco l’output del comando.
Chiudere la connessione al database.
Ecco lo script Python completo.
Conclusione
Ottimizza la gestione dei dati in Python con SQLite. Semplifica l’archiviazione, il recupero e la manipolazione dei dati, consentendo un flusso di lavoro efficiente e approfondimenti basati sui dati. Migliora le tue capacità di gestione dei dati senza sforzo.